Regent's Canal Company, London; Edmund Leonard Snee (1793-1864), Secretary [ Sir John Edward Harington of Ridlington, 8th Barone
Regent's Canal Company London. Seven items comprising five printed circulars an Autograph Letters Signed from secretary Edmund Leonard Snee to Sir John Edward Harington and the autograph draft of Harington's letter.
Regent's Canal Company. Regent's Canal Office 98 Great Russell Street Bloomsbury. London Between 1827 and 1831. First proposed by Thomas Horner in 1802 the Regent's Canal was incorporated by John Nash in 1811 in his plans for the development of Regent's Park. Hugely-successful in the nineteenth century despite the rise of the railways it fell into decline in the early twentieth but is now firmly established as an amenity of London. The seven items in the present collection are in good condition on lightly aged and worn paper. Items ONE to FOUR are printed circulars from Snee transmitting copies 'of the Resolutions this day passed at the General Assembly of Proprietors of the Regent's Canal'. All from the Regent's Canal Office. Dated: 6 June 1827; 3 June 1829; 2 June 1830; 1 June 1831. The first is preceded by a circular letter from Snee regarding a share issue to raise funds to pay off the company's debt to the government; the last three contain statements of receipts and expenditure. All four are 3pp. 8vo on bifoliums and all are addressed with postmarks to 'Sir J. E. Harington Bart. Berkeley Square.' FIVE: Printed circular letter from Snee. Regent's Canal Office; 18 July 1827. 1p. 4to. Addressed to Harington with postmarks. Items One to Six are docketed by Harington. Begins 'The Measure adopted at the late General Meeting having produced a Subscription of 8367 Shares in the proportion of three New for every four Old Shares amounting to £209175; and of 3346 Surplus Shares in case of a deficiency under the 4th Resolution; …'. SIX: Autograph Letter Signed 'Edmund. L. Snee. Secy.' from Snee to Harington replying to Item Seven below. Regent's Canal Office; 12 June 1827. 2pp. 4to. Stating following consultation with the Deputy Chairman that 'the gross amount of the Revenue calculated on the average of the last three months exceeds £30000 – Per Annum. - The ascertained annual Expenses of the Concern amount to about £9000 but to this must be added the Repairs – wear & tear &c. and Expenses of working the Tunnel Engine making the current outgoings amount altogether to about £12000.' Continues regarding the 'Surplus Receipts' and states what will be done 'in the event of the requisite Sum not being raised in time to accomplish the Object of paying off the Company's debt to Government'. SEVEN: Autograph Signed Draft of letter from Harington to Snee. Berkeley Square; 11 June 1827. 2pp. 12mo. He finds regarding Item One above that 'no clue is therein afforded to form any judgment of the probable surplus receipts from which a rate of dividend may be reasonably expected should the sum required or £223000 be raised in the manner proposed'. It is 'desirable to ascertain if in the event of the object not being attained by a subscription for so large a number of shares' the deposits on the new shares will be returned.
